As an Area Manager, you'll lead a team of Business Relationship Managers (BRMs) in developing new business and deepening existing relationships to position Chase as the primary bank for our clients.
Responsibilities (in order of importance):
Provide leadership, management, support, direction, and guidance to a team of BRMs within a territory in developing new deposit, cash management, and credit business while focusing on relationship-building, client experience, and risk management
Manage performance of individual team members, holding all BRMs accountable for achieving business priorities with a focus on client experience and risk management
Manage the area's revenue and profitability and monitor adherence to credit quality, regulatory requirements, and risk protocols; utilize reporting and metrics to monitor team performance, identify trends, and address or escalate issues in a timely manner
Coach and develop team on all aspects of managing a portfolio, including relationship management, prospecting, profitability, client experience, and risk management; provide expertise to team on loan structuring, pricing, and developing customized solutions; help team identify solutions to complex challenges
Hold BRMs accountable for understanding the personal financial goals and needs of their business clients and connecting them with specialists who can help meet their financial needs
Build collaborative relationships with partners across lines of business - Chase Wealth Management, Home Lending, Branch Teams, Commercial Bank, and Private Bank - to foster a One Chase, client-centric environment
Actively recruit and maintain a pipeline of diverse viable candidates; select, hire, develop and retain top quality talent by creating an inclusive and respectful team environment
Represent bank in a community leadership capacity such as Chamber of Commerce and local non-profit boards
Qualifications:
Seven or more years of experience in a business banking relationship management role or related business lending experience; direct in-person contact required
Bachelor's degree in Finance or related field or equivalent work experience strongly preferred
Prior experience in managing a relationship development team preferred
Expert knowledge of deposit and cash management products and services
Expert knowledge of business credit underwriting with commercial credit training preferred
Strong communication skills with individuals at all levels, internally and externally
Ability to analyze reports, metrics, and other data to identify trends, issues, and opportunities
Proven ability to build collaborative relationships across the organization and influence others to achieve desired outcomes
Ability to balance needs of clients with associated risks and interests of the firm
Consistently use a disciplined process to manage time; use time strategically to balance long-term and day-to-day demands of management role
Ability to lead proactively through change
Strong current business network; viewed as a leader in community organizations with demonstrated business acumen
Highly proficient in MS Office tools including Outlook, Excel, Word, and PowerPoint
Ability to travel occasionally for key business and leadership meetings and training
